Loris Vergier won Downhill World Championships in Andorra with a near-perfect run in one of the tightest podium battles you’ll ever see. He displayed the precision and focus that has made him one of the best riders ever in a ruthless sport. Before the race, however, he battled doubts about his own ability in the midst of an up-and-down season.
